Flew to Budapest in two flights from Newcastle today. Took the express bus 25 minutes from the airport to the city center for $6.14.
Then, used the Metro like a lost American clown. My Hungarian ain’t good. Many people speak English but place names are in Hungarian.
After the Metro, which I got off too early, used a Bolt taxi to get to within 50m of my Airbnb. Bolts can be ordered online like an Uber but I just found one parked and knocked on the window.
The Airbnb is small but nice and it’s in the old city center. And, it’s cheaper than a hotel, comes with a kitchen and washer.
Looked for a Hungarian restaurant at 10 PM but ran across a hole-in-the-wall Indian takeaway restaurant first. Tasty lamb curry over rice with a Hungarian beer.
